Research on Fabrication and Performance of Plasma Sprayed 8YSZ Ceramic-Based Composite Coating
In order to improve the heat resistance of carbon fiber reinforced resin matrix composites
Ni/NiCrAlY/8YSZ(ZrO
2
– 8%Y
2
O
3
) composite coatings were prepared on cyanate ester resin-based carbon fiber substrate by plasma spraying
and the phase composition and microstructure of the coatings were analyzed by X-ray diffraction (XRD) and scanning electron microscopy (SEM). The heat resistance of Ni/NiCrAlY/8YSZ composite coating was studied by using the ablation resistance test. The results show that the Ni/NiCrAlY/8YSZ composite coating prepared by plasma spraying has a compact structure
and there are no obvious defects such as interlaminar gaps and pores
and the composite coating can protect the substrate well after the ablation test
